Tourist Guide Benicia

Benicia is a city that can be found in the county of Solano, in the state of California in the United States. This city is also the first city that was founded by Anglo-Americans. It is a beautiful waterside city as it is surrounded by the San Francisco Bay and also the Carquinez Strait. The western part of this city is occupied by Vallejo and the Martinez regions. The city is divided into four regions for administrative uses. Most of the residents reside in the western region. This city is also home to Benicia Arsenal, a major US armoury which is very efficient. The city is measured to be 40.4 sq. kilometres vast with most of it covered by land. This city is also known for its markets and fairs which are held on a weekly basis. The total number of people residing here is 26,865 according to a recent census. This city is a mixture of Whites, Hispanic and also Latinos. The Benicia Breeze is a very developed means of transport used here.
